- How online violence affects mental health : a relationship to understandPublication . Gadomski, Gaëlle; Reis, Marta SofiaOnline violence has emerged as a growing health concern due to its psychological impact on individuals across diverse social groups. This study aimed to investigate the impact of online violence on mental health, focusing specifically on symptoms of depression, anxiety, and post-traumatic stress. A quantitative, cross-sectional design was employed with a sample of 250, divided into two groups: participants who had experienced online violence (OV group) and those who had not (Control group). Participants completed an anonymous online questionnaire, which included validated French versions of the CES-D, BAI, and IES-R scales. Statistical analyses revealed significantly higher scores on all three scales for the OV group compared to the Control group, with large to very large effect sizes (p < .001). These findings underscore the serious psychological toll of online violence and highlight the need for more comprehensive prevention strategies, public awareness, and mental health support services tailored to digital contexts.
